Rev. Charles L. Stubblefield, age 93, passed away on Wednesday, January 29, 2020 at Church Street Manor in Ecru. He was born April 19, 1926 to DeWitt and Mattie Weaver Stubblefield. Charles was a graduate of Ingomar High School and later obtained a Master’s of Divinity from the New Orleans Baptist Theological Seminary. He was an active Baptist Minister for 60 years, serving as Pastor, Interim Pastor and Director of Missions during his service. Charles served on the Executive Committee of the MS Baptist Convention Board, the Lion’s Club, PTA, Woodmen of the World, New Albany American Legion and the “Ecru Good Timers”. He was also a WWII Navy Veteran, where he served on the USS San Diego as a radio operator. Charles enjoyed gardening, woodworking, reading and calligraphy.
